Transaction f3181368d7707fcce0d8e7969a61c9590ca23f995ed20239162c9afcacca29af
1 Input
1 Output
-
f3181368d7707fcce0d8e7969a61c9590ca23f995ed20239162c9afcacca29af:0
- value
- 20985060
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2aff2df861e056d6eb9806609cb42fba4e40602f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14vM5FAtnFAonzB57EGrLzREhsZeM5dbDk